2 dead in boiler blast at dairy factory in Rajasthan

Two workers, Mahadev Gurjar, 35, and Radheshyam Gurjar, 25, died in a boiler explosion at a mawa factory in Narayanpur village, Bhilwara district, on Friday night. The incident occurred during their duty shift while most colleagues were on Diwali leave. Authorities are investigating the cause of the blast and have initiated an inquiry into the circumstances.
